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ost In Braithwaite, LA

The cost of skylight le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Braithwaite, LA. These estimates are based on industry averages and may not reflect your specific situation.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Removal $500 – $2,000 Amount of water, equipment required
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ment required
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, materials required
Specialized Equipment Rental $100 – $500 Equipment required, rental duration
Insurance Navigation $100 – $500 Insurance coverage, provider complexity

What causes skylight leaks?

Skylight le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including damaged or rotten wood, worn-out seals, and clogged gutters. Regular maintenance can help prevent leaks and reduce the risk of water damage.

How do I prevent skylight leaks?

Preventing skylight leaks needs regular maintenance, including inspecting and sealing gaps or cracks, cleaning gutters, and checking for damaged or rotten wood. Stay on top of maintenance to prevent costly repairs.
